Create XEN Develop DomU

DOMAIN_NAME=dev
 
# install vm
xen-create-image --hostname=${DOMAIN_NAME} --ip=192.168.1.33 --gateway=192.168.1.5 --netmask=255.255.255.0 \
--lvm=vg01 --dist=intrepid --mirror=http://archive.ubuntu.com/ubuntu/ --size=8Gb --memory=512Mb --swap=2Gb
 
# rename config file
mv /etc/xen/${DOMAIN_NAME}.cfg /etc/xen/${DOMAIN_NAME}
 
# start domain
xm create -c ${DOMAIN_NAME}
 
# set root password
passwd
 
# install apps
apt-get install -y debootstrap squashfs-tools
 
 
# OPTIONAL
# create DomU backup
mount /dev/vg01/${DOMAIN_NAME}-disk /mnt/
cd /mnt/
tar cjf /root/xen.dev-disk.tar.bz2 *
cd
umount /mnt/
 
# RESTORE
mkfs.ext3 /dev/vg01/${DOMAIN_NAME}-disk
mount /dev/vg01/${DOMAIN_NAME}-disk /mnt/
tar xjf xen.dev-disk.tar.bz2 -C /mnt/
umount /mnt/

Do you like this page? Then support it. Please click the AD below and visit the sponsor. Thank you!